Transaction 6842dab4ba767eb6616edf87ffd703548166d20411a715e2b8a747200c8a0769

1 Input
2 Outputs
  • 6842dab4ba767eb6616edf87ffd703548166d20411a715e2b8a747200c8a0769:0
  • value  6300193
    address  1KKgWBed1MMvFtRQRfoHWfruy5rcW1YTma
  • 6842dab4ba767eb6616edf87ffd703548166d20411a715e2b8a747200c8a0769:1
  • value  569967604
    address  1AtFaXp4fwDNo4pgD7yGp1BUcc5EZzCt6N